使用“压力”进行 CPU 压力测试

H3R*_*T1K 5 cpu stress-testing 16.04

我打算通过实时会话对我的 OCed AMD Athlon X4 880K 进行压力测试。我听说过“压力”工具。如何用于CPU压力测试?我计划用 lm_sensors 监控温度。您知道使“传感器”以合理间隔运行的正确语法吗?

Col*_*ing 10

作为stress-ng的作者,我个人推荐它,因为它具有广泛的压力测试,可用于以多种不同方式锻炼CPU。

有很多方法可以锻炼 CPU,使用stress-ng 可以告诉它运行所有可以使用以下方法对CPU 施加压力的压力源:

stress-ng --class cpu --sequential 0 -t 60 -v
Run Code Online (Sandbox Code Playgroud)

..并检查热区信息中的温度,可以使用:

stress-ng --class cpu --sequential 4 -t 60 -v --tz
Run Code Online (Sandbox Code Playgroud)

以上将在启用详细模式和 4 个 CPU 上的热区统计信息的情况下一个一个(顺序地)运行 cpu 类压力源 60 秒

或者可以运行特定的压力源,例如:

应力-ng --matrix 0 -t 2m

..这将在所有 CPU(0 = 所有 CPU)上运行矩阵压力器 2 分钟。

带有stress-ng 的手册详细说明了所有选项。有超过 170 种压力源可供使用。要查看所有压力源,请使用:

stress-ng --help | less
Run Code Online (Sandbox Code Playgroud)

  • 我使用“stress-ng”来测试我的欠压偏移。与声称是“当今”可用的最激进的压力测试软件的 [Linpack Xtreme](https://www.techpowerup.com/download/linpack-xtreme/) 相比,它似乎以更高的时钟速度利用我的 CPU。 (2认同)

ama*_*usk 3

如果您想尝试使用 TUI 格式的压力,请尝试使用 s-tui。这是我们创建的一个终端 UI 应用程序,专门用于压力和监控温度的目的。

它可以在 github 和 PyPi 上找到。https://amanusk.github.io/s-tui/

使用 pip 安装是: sudo pip install s-tui

您仍然需要安装stress或stress-ng,但您可以从s-tui内部更改参数。默认设置是在所有核心上运行无限时间。